NAPERVILLE, IL — A Naperville man is facing felony gun charges after a routine traffic stop led officers to find a gun in his hotel room, according to police. Yusuf Syed, 21, of the 25 W 200 block of Concord, was charged with aggravated unlawful use of a weapon and conspiracy — aggravated unlawful use of a weapon, in connection with the March 1 incident. Syed was stopped near the intersection of Naper Boulevard and Ridgeland Avenue around 6:45 p.m. for failing to use a turn signal, according to police. Police say they found a "small amount" of cannabis during the investigation, per a news release from Naperville Police Department spokesperson Michaus Williams. Police ultimately got consent to search Syed's motel room, where they say they found a P80 9 mm handgun, Williams told Patch. According to DuPage County Jail records, Syed did not possess a Firearm Owner's Identification (FOID) card for the gun.
